Find & Apply For Marketing Manager Jobs In York, South Carolina
Marketing Manager jobs in York, South Carolina involve developing marketing strategies, overseeing campaigns, analyzing market trends, and collaborating with various teams. Responsibilities also include managing budgets, promoting products/services, and ensuring brand consistency. Strong communication, leadership, and analytical skills are critical for success in this role. Below you can find different Marketing Manager positions in York, South Carolina.

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Marketing Managers in York, South Carolina play a crucial role in shaping the local businesses' outreach and growth strategies. - Entry-level Marketing Coordinator salaries range from $40,000 to $50,000 per year - Mid-career Marketing Manager salaries range from $55,000 to $75,000 per year - Senior Marketing Director salaries range from $80,000 to $120,000 per year The role of a Marketing Manager in York has deep roots, tracing back to the early days of the town's industrial expansion when local businesses began to see the value in structured advertising and market research. Over the decades, the function of the Marketing Manager in York has transformed significantly, transitioning from traditional methods like print media to incorporating digital strategies and data analytics to better target potential markets and measure campaign effectiveness. Recent trends for Marketing Managers in York involve a strong emphasis on digital marketing, with a focus on social media engagement, content marketing, and the use of SEO and SEM strategies to enhance online visibility and influence consumer behavior.
